Motivation
We’ve got everything we need to be amazing right now.
Chris Barèz-Brown
- Stop comparing yourself to others
- Don’t what-if your situations
- Stop thinking you need to “have something” in order to do something, to feel better, or make it to the next stage.
Everything you need is right in front of you. Look in the mirror or anything that gives you a reflection, and tell yourself that you have all you need.
Learn how to work with what you have. When you need something else, you’ll know and it will come to you.
Reflection
- What are you grateful for today?
- What do you need to get done, but have been putting off because you felt you didn’t have what you needed?
- How many times have you compared yourself to someone today?
- How many times have you “what-if’ed” today?
Sit down, take a deep breath, and write down your answers to the questions above. Think about how you feel after writing it down.
